Features a collection of essays, commentary, poems, etc.: "In Daylight - I" and "Elegy" by John Lehmann, "The Two Loves" and "Some Notes on 'King Lear'" by Edith Sitwell, "Lament" by George Barker, "Island Dances" by George Seferis, "I Hear You Say So" by Elizabeth Bowen, "Five Poems" by Terence Tiller, "No News From Home" by Cecil Keeling, "The Woman Who Was Loved" by James Stern, "The Poems" by Peter Yates, "Two Poems" by Odysseus Elytis, "The Man Who Killed" by Jiri Weiss, "War" by Andre Chamson, "The Hidden Force" by William Plomer, "The Pre-Raphaelite Literary Painters" by Stephen Spender, "W.H. Auden in America" and "The Place and the Person" by Henry Reed, plus other contributions by Heinrich Fischer, Hero Pesopoulos, Demetrios Capetanakis, Alexander Astruc, J. MacLaren-Ross, C.H. Peacock, J.P. Hodin, and Percy Coates. The eldest daughter of Charles T. "Hal" Hallinan (1880-1971), novelist Nancy Hallinan (1921-2014) authored the critically acclaimed novels "Rough Winds of May" (1955), "A Voice from the Wings" (1965), and "Night Swimmers" (1976) as well as the 1980 O'Henry award winning short story "Women in a Roman Courtyard." Her papers are held by Boston University's Howard Gotlieb Archival Research Center.

Small snag to top of spine but good-plus. Lacks dust-wrapper. This is a good examination of the biology and taxonomy of fish, both saltwater and freshwater. Chapters include, migration; locomotion; hibernation and estivation; fishes dangerous to man; feeding habits; association with other animals; fighting fishes; males that incubate; electricity and luminescence; sound and sight; ocean beach spawners; giants and dwarfs; nest builders in streams; fishes controllable by man; home aquaria; fishes suitable for aquaria; classification of fishes. .
